Ours is an ex-library copy in transparent protective covering, with usual stickers and stamps.Book in FAIR condition At the peak of a brilliant career, Vaslav Nijinsky went mad. Twenty-five years later, as the Red Army advances across Nazi-occupied Hungary, the horror and disruption of war awaken in him glorious and humiliating memories (including his bizarre relationship with Diaghilev, and the fiasco of his American tour) contributing to his paranoia and spiritual confusion. This is a fictionalised reconstruction of his last days.
